OneToOneMapping

Source file "org/eclipse/persistence/mappings/OneToOneMapping.java" was not found during generation of report.

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total3,855 of 3,8550%502 of 5020%362362874874111111
buildObjectJoinExpression(Expression, Object, AbstractSession)3000%420%2222656511
initialize(AbstractSession)2520%520%2727505011
writeFromObjectIntoRowInternal(Object, AbstractRecord, AbstractSession, OneToOneMapping.ShallowMode, DatabaseMapping.WriteType)1900%520%2727555511
clone()1790%160%99434311
buildObjectJoinExpression(Expression, Expression, AbstractSession)1690%160%99363611
createMapComponentsFromSerializableKeyInfo(Object[], AbstractSession)1390%120%77252511
initializeForeignKeysWithDefaults(AbstractSession)1210%120%77272711
postInitializeSourceAndTargetExpressions()1110%320%1717272711
postUpdate(WriteObjectQuery)930%120%77232311
extractKeyFromReferenceObject(Object, AbstractSession)860%100%66191911
buildSelectionCriteria(boolean, boolean)860%120%77242411
executeBatchQuery(DatabaseQuery, CacheKey, Map, AbstractSession, AbstractRecord)830%60%44161611
valueFromObject(Object, DatabaseField, AbstractSession)800%100%66181811
valueFromRowInternalWithJoin(AbstractRecord, JoinedAttributeManager, ObjectBuildingQuery, CacheKey, AbstractSession, boolean)750%120%77141411
initializeForeignKeys(AbstractSession)720%40%33171711
postInsert(WriteObjectQuery)700%80%55151511
initializePrivateOwnedCriteria()680%60%44141411
extractBatchKeyFromRow(AbstractRecord, AbstractSession)650%60%44171711
buildBatchCriteria(ExpressionBuilder, ObjectLevelReadQuery)610%60%44101011
getOrderedForeignKeyFields()590%80%55161611
OneToOneMapping()570%n/a11151511
setSourceToTargetKeyFieldAssociations(Vector)560%20%22111111
buildShallowOriginalFromRow(AbstractRecord, Object, JoinedAttributeManager, ObjectBuildingQuery, AbstractSession)530%20%22121211
extractPrimaryKeysForReferenceObjectFromRow(AbstractRecord)520%60%44111111
extendPessimisticLockScopeInSourceQuery(ObjectLevelReadQuery)470%20%22101011
extractIdentityFieldsForQuery(Object, AbstractSession)400%20%227711
postPrepareNestedBatchQuery(ReadQuery, ObjectLevelReadQuery)400%120%777711
getSourceToTargetKeyFieldAssociations()400%20%229911
getOrderByNormalizedExpressions(Expression)370%40%337711
writeFromAttributeIntoRow(Object, AbstractRecord, AbstractSession)350%40%339911
valueFromRowInternal(AbstractRecord, JoinedAttributeManager, ObjectBuildingQuery, AbstractSession, boolean)350%60%447711
performDataModificationEvent(Object[], AbstractSession)330%20%226611
addAdditionalFieldsToQuery(ReadQuery, Expression)310%60%447711
preDelete(DeleteObjectQuery)300%60%445511
readPrivateOwnedForObject(ObjectLevelModifyQuery)290%40%337711
writeFromObjectIntoRowWithChangeRecord(ChangeRecord, AbstractRecord, AbstractSession, DatabaseMapping.WriteType)290%60%445511
writeInsertFieldsIntoRow(AbstractRecord, AbstractSession)290%80%558811
createStubbedMapComponentFromSerializableKeyInfo(Object, AbstractSession)280%n/a116611
updateInsertableAndUpdatableFields(DatabaseField)270%40%337711
writeFromObjectIntoRowForUpdateAfterShallowInsert(Object, AbstractRecord, AbstractSession, DatabaseTable)270%80%554411
writeFromObjectIntoRowForUpdateBeforeShallowDelete(Object, AbstractRecord, AbstractSession, DatabaseTable)270%80%554411
checkCacheForBatchKey(AbstractRecord, Object, Map, ReadQuery, ObjectLevelReadQuery, AbstractSession)260%80%556611
getAdditionalTablesForJoinQuery()260%20%225511
getAllFieldsForMapKey()250%n/a114411
rehashFieldDependancies(AbstractSession)250%40%336611
getFieldClassification(DatabaseField)240%40%337711
writeFromObjectIntoRowForShallowInsertWithChangeRecord(ChangeRecord, AbstractRecord, AbstractSession)240%60%448811
getForeignKeyFieldNames()230%20%225511
prepareCascadeLockingPolicy()230%20%224411
setForeignKeyFieldNames(Vector)230%20%225511
postInitializeMapKey(MappedKeyMapContainerPolicy)220%40%335511
setForeignKeyFieldName(String)210%n/a115511
addForeignKeyField(DatabaseField, DatabaseField)200%n/a115511
shouldWriteField(DatabaseField, DatabaseMapping.WriteType)200%40%335511
collectQueryParameters(Set)180%20%224411
createQueryKeyForMapKey()180%n/a115511
addFieldsForMapKey(AbstractRecord)160%20%224411
writeFromObjectIntoRow(Object, AbstractRecord, AbstractSession, DatabaseMapping.WriteType)150%40%334411
writeFromObjectIntoRowForShallowInsert(Object, AbstractRecord, AbstractSession)150%40%334411
buildSelectionQueryForDirectCollectionKeyMapping(ContainerPolicy)140%n/a114411
extendPessimisticLockScopeInTargetQuery(ObjectLevelReadQuery, ObjectBuildingQuery)140%20%224411
getExtendPessimisticLockScopeDedicatedQuery(AbstractSession, short)140%20%223311
setTargetForeignKeyFieldName(String)140%n/a113311
addTargetForeignKeyField(DatabaseField, DatabaseField)130%n/a113311
addForeignKeyFieldName(String, String)110%n/a112211
addTargetForeignKeyFieldName(String, String)110%n/a112211
buildElementClone(Object, Object, CacheKey, Integer, AbstractSession, boolean, boolean)110%n/a111111
hasRelationTable()110%40%331111
collectFields()110%20%223311
isOwned()100%40%331111
createMapComponentFromJoinedRow(AbstractRecord, JoinedAttributeManager, ObjectBuildingQuery, CacheKey, AbstractSession, boolean)90%n/a111111
getForeignKeysToPrimaryKeys()90%20%223311
getPrimaryKeyDescriptor()90%20%223311
getRelationTable()90%20%223311
getPrivateOwnedCriteria()80%20%223311
createSerializableMapKeyInfo(Object, AbstractSession)70%n/a111111
getTargetVersionOfSourceObject(Object, Object, MergeManager, AbstractSession)70%n/a111111
unwrapKey(Object, AbstractSession)70%n/a111111
wrapKey(Object, AbstractSession)70%n/a111111
hasRelationTableMechanism()70%20%221111
addKeyToDeletedObjectsList(Object, Map)60%n/a112211
createMapComponentFromRow(AbstractRecord, ObjectBuildingQuery, CacheKey, AbstractSession, boolean)60%n/a111111
getNestedJoinQuery(JoinedAttributeManager, ObjectLevelReadQuery, AbstractSession)60%n/a111111
iterateOnMapKey(DescriptorIterator, Object)60%n/a112211
deleteMapKey(Object, AbstractSession)50%n/a112211
getAdditionalSelectionCriteriaForMapKey()50%n/a111111
buildSelectionCriteria()50%n/a111111
setRelationTable(DatabaseTable)50%n/a112211
getFieldsForTranslationInAggregate()40%n/a111111
preinitializeMapKey(DatabaseTable)40%n/a112211
setIsOneToOneRelationship(boolean)40%n/a112211
setIsOneToOnePrimaryKeyRelationship(boolean)40%n/a112211
setPrivateOwnedCriteria(Expression)40%n/a112211
setShouldVerifyDelete(boolean)40%n/a112211
setSourceToTargetKeyFields(Map)40%n/a112211
setTargetToSourceKeyFields(Map)40%n/a112211
setRelationTableMechanism(RelationTableMechanism)40%n/a112211
getForeignKeyFieldsForMapKey()30%n/a111111
getIdentityFieldsForMapKey()30%n/a111111
getSourceToTargetKeyFields()30%n/a111111
getTargetToSourceKeyFields()30%n/a111111
getMapKeyTargetType()30%n/a111111
isOneToOneRelationship()30%n/a111111
isOneToOnePrimaryKeyRelationship()30%n/a111111
shouldVerifyDelete()30%n/a111111
getRelationTableMechanism()30%n/a111111
isRelationalMapping()0%n/a111111
isOneToOneMapping()0%n/a111111
requiresDataModificationEventsForMapKey()0%n/a111111
isCascadedLockingSupported()0%n/a111111
isJoiningSupported()0%n/a111111